  13. SIBU: A total of 1,561 passengers were affected when 12 flights to and from Sibu were cancelled due to the closure of Sibu Airport runway yesterday evening. Sibu Airport manager Zainuddin Abu Nasir said the decision was made following detection of faulty runway edge lights. read more below: https://www.theborneopost.com/2019/08/14/faulty-runway-edge-lights-force-cancellation-of-flights/ and in Malay: https://www.utusanborneo.com.my/2019/08/13/lapangan-terbang-sibu-ditutup-susulan-lampu-landasan-rosak-beroperasi-semula-pagi-rabu All night inbound and outbound flights are cancelled due to the faulty light last night. However the lights was successfully repaired at 7.50pm, however due to safety reasons, MAHB (alongside with the agreement with AK and MASwings), decided to close down the runway for night operations,as they need to repair and stabilise the runway lights.
